How did Max Freedom Long define Huna?
Max Freedom Long, who rediscovered Huna in the 1920s, defined it as a system of religious psychiatry because it contains elements of religion, psychology, and psychic science.

Is is legal to use real people in fiction?
You can; many fictional works are set in the "real" world or in variations of the real world - for example, in a novel about current America, Obama might be mentioned. However, there are legal implications about writing about living people so authors, and more particularly publishers, have to be cautious about such things.

What is an author's purpose in having a character not fit in or be at odds with a story's setting?
You usually have a character who doesn't fit in when you want to show something from an outside viewpoint, to spotlight something that everybody else thinks is totally normal.
How do you relate to a main character?
You relate to a character usually by a feeling that the main character has on a topic or an event that the main character goes through.
The usual "Yes, that is exactly how I feel!" feeling means you can relate to the character.
That is how authors form their characters. Authors try to make their characters able to relate to you. That way you can be more drawn into the story, go deeper with the characters, etc.
For example, the well known character Percy Jackson from the series Percy Jackson and the Olympians is very easy to relate to, which is one of the main reasons why the series is a best selling series.
The author formed him into the everyday kid, so every kid could relate to something about Percy.
Percy Jackson feels left out, his parents are separated, he has ADHD, he is dyslexic, he does not know if he will ever be known or loved by someone, he does not think he looks good enough, etc.
Every kid/ teen has these feelings and can relate to Percy's situation, so they read on to figure out how Percy Jackson handles these trials.
But like the answer says at the top, you can usually relate to a character by a similar feeling, hope, event, or wish.

Does a plot summary need to include the solution?
When you are doing a plot summary, you should include all of the major points of the story, so yes, you include the ending. If the story has a surprise or twist, you might give a hint and say "You should really read this story to see the surprise ending."
How does the setting affect the narrator?
It might not. Sometimes the setting is integral to the story - the narrator is going to act differently depending on where and when the story is set. But sometimes the setting is just a backdrop, and the story can take place anywhere and anywhen.

A story can be either plot driven, character driven, or both. Most are stories are both but one or the other usually takes precedence. Charles Dickens' novels are primarily character driven Ian Flemings' are plot driven (although all the plots are the same.) If you need a place to start - trying thinking up interesting characters who can be developed and evolved against an interesting plot, or think up a good crisis that characters can be illuminated through.

How is professional writing different from other kinds of writing?
Professional just means that someone has mastered the craft. All writing is basically the same. Amateur writers tend to make grammatical mistakes, ramble instead of getting to the point, write confusingly instead of clearly, and fail to understand what's selling on the current market. Professional writers can produce a clear, concise and correct manuscript without as much effort as it takes an amateur to produce the same thing.
